Default House specifications in Oz

I have been looking at the websites of builders in WA and I am bemused and fascinated by the specifications that I see for new homes. Many have a family room AND a sitting room AND a theatre room. I don't know if I could devote so many rooms in one house to sitting on my arse!

I also think it's a bit strange that almost all homes only have 2 bathrooms. In a 5 bed house I would expect 3 bathrooms. Even the UK has gone ensuite crazy with some properties having an ensuite to every bedroom.

To those with the three living areas - how do you find the arrangement? Do you actually use all the spaces?
